About

Bruce S Klein is a real estate attorney with more than 39 years of legal experience, practicing at Shechtman Halperin Savage, LLP in White Plains, NY. He earned a B.A. from Rutgers College in 1981 and a J.D. from Western New England College School of Law in 1984. He is admitted to practice in New York (since 1987) and Massachusetts (since 1985). His practice encompasses real estate, estate planning, and mergers and acquisitions, allowing him to serve clients across a range of legal needs. He maintains a clean professional disciplinary record.
